diff options
author | frsfnrrg <frsfnrrg@users.noreply.github.com> | 2018-07-17 11:19:32 -0400 |
---|---|---|
committer | frsfnrrg <frsfnrrg@users.noreply.github.com> | 2018-07-17 11:35:00 -0400 |
commit | 600676688a47bde05bc12110818127c5300dd876 (patch) | |
tree | aa359ee81e7148668eeeba6622a5b7b381747921 /sway/criteria.c | |
parent | Fix uninitialized pointer in view_unmap (diff) | |
download | sway-600676688a47bde05bc12110818127c5300dd876.tar.gz sway-600676688a47bde05bc12110818127c5300dd876.tar.zst sway-600676688a47bde05bc12110818127c5300dd876.zip |
Free individual criteria in free_config
Also free cmd_list when cleaning up a struct criteria.
Diffstat (limited to 'sway/criteria.c')
-rw-r--r-- | sway/criteria.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sway/criteria.c b/sway/criteria.c index c999d248..e2b248de 100644 --- a/sway/criteria.c +++ b/sway/criteria.c | |||
@@ -37,7 +37,7 @@ void criteria_destroy(struct criteria *criteria) { | |||
37 | pcre_free(criteria->con_mark); | 37 | pcre_free(criteria->con_mark); |
38 | pcre_free(criteria->window_role); | 38 | pcre_free(criteria->window_role); |
39 | free(criteria->workspace); | 39 | free(criteria->workspace); |
40 | 40 | free(criteria->cmdlist); | |
41 | free(criteria->raw); | 41 | free(criteria->raw); |
42 | free(criteria); | 42 | free(criteria); |
43 | } | 43 | } |